Advice - Recall program: Flash my device or uninstall TegraOTA?

Hi guys,

My original Nvidia Tablet got affected by the recall program but I'd like to keep the old one as a backup.

I hear my two options are the following ones but I don't know which one to pick:
- Flash my tablet with a custom ROM
- Uninstall the TegraOTA file and check-out the OTA download links on XDA to still be able to get updates.

So I have a couple of questions:
- It seems like choosing the flashing option comes with drawbacks (no sound over HDMi anymore for example). What is the full list of drawback which comes with flashing a custom ROM on an Nvidia tablet (are the console mode and the controller going to still work properly? It doesn't seem like they will ...)
- If I go with the flashing option, I don't need anything fancy so which ROM should I choose? I hear Resurrection Remix M and Bliss are popular choices. Which one is the most user friendly? And what would be the best way to save and reinstall my video game saves (Helium?)?
- What are the drawbacks of the second option (uninstall the TegraOTA).
- Am I missing other interesting options here?

Note: I've searched through XDA but couldn't answer all of my questions. I'm new to that world but I'm willing to learn!
